    Abstract: In a friction clutch for motor vehicles the pressure plate is connected to the clutch housing for common rotation about the common axis by a plurality of leaf springs which are tangential with respect to the common axis of the clutch housing and the pressure plate. The clutch housing has a predetermined direction of rotation which results from the sense of rotation of the combustion engine which is to be connected by the respective frictional clutch to the gear box of the motor vehicle. The leaf springs have--with respect to the predetermined direction of rotation--a leading end portion and a trailing end portion. The leading end portion of all leaf spring elements are fastened to the pressure plate and the trailing end portions of all leaf springs are fastened to the clutch housing.

    Abstract: A decoupling device for gear motors used in cargo conveyor belt systems in which a coupler member is free to move axially on the output shaft of the gear motor to cooperate with the final gear of the gear train in the motor housing. A spring member maintains the coupler in engagement with the final gear via the corresponding jaw structures. Disengagement of the respective jaw structures is accomplished by axially moving the coupler member along the output shaft by means of a self-securing pivotally mounted yoke which engages the coupler for transmitting axial motion thereto. The yoke is pivoted by means of a cam follower device mounted for pivotal movement exteriorly of the gear housing to thereby rotate to one of two positions, thus connecting or disconnecting the aforementioned respective jaw structures on the output shaft.

    Abstract: A clutch is interposed between the driving gears of a grinding mill and the driving motor to protect the gears from damage by mechanical overloading. The clutch is set to slip at torques below those required to structurally damage the gears yet higher than design load and the clutch released and the mill is shut down after a preset degree of clutch slippage occurs.

    Abstract: A clutch/brake apparatus for alternatively connecting a driven shaft to a driving member and to a stationary member which distributes the mass of its components to maximize the effective rotational inertia of the driving member and to minimize the effective rotational inertia of the driven shaft. Sets of interleaved brake plates are respectively mounted to the driven shaft and the stationary member and sets of interleaved clutch plates are respectively mounted to the driven shaft and the driving member. A clutch operator for urging the clutch plates together when it is moved in a first axial direction is connected to rotate with the driving member and a brake operator for urging the brake plates together when it is moved in a second axial direction is rotationally stationary and is connected by a bearing to move axially with the clutch operator.

    Abstract: A method of controlling the starting of a vehicle having an engine, an automatic clutch and an electronic control system which detects the extent of depression of an accelerator pedal and determines the speed of operation of a clutch actuator based on the detected extent of depression of the accelerator pedal. In particular, the method includes detecting a load on the engine due to a change in the condition in which the clutch is engaged, and stopping connection control of the clutch when the detected load on the engine is increased, to prevent an engine stop. In addition correction is made to vary the speed at which the vehicle starts linearly with respect to the extent of depression of the accelerator pedal.

    Abstract: A viscous fan clutch which employs a dynamic blocker ring positioned inside of the clutch between the pump plate and the clutch plate in such a manner that the fluid flow path is directed and not left to chance. The blocker ring, in effect, hydraulically separates the drive portion of the clutch from the pump and viscous fluid storage portion. The divider ring due to its location will provide support outboard of the bearing providing optimized durability.

    Abstract: A transmission with free-wheel capability comprises a bolt slidingly mounted in a bell-housing integral with a driving shaft, adapted for engagement in a cage provided with rollers and mounted in the bell-housing for movement between two positions in which the rollers and the bell-housing are in abutment so that a driving and a driven shaft are coupled to rotate together. The bolt maintains the cage in a middle position in which the driven shaft is disengaged and allowed to free-wheel, when the transmission is in forward travel and not in any braking condition. An electromagnet draws the bolt into the cage. This device ensures the free-wheel setting of the vehicle in forward travel up to a predetermined speed. At higher speeds a safety system automatically couples the driving and driven shafts together again.

    Abstract: A multidisk clutch comprises an external bell member adapted to be coupled to a driving shaft and an internal ring member concentric with the bell member adapted to be coupled to a driven shaft. A plurality of disk members are disposed between the bell member and the ring member. Certain of these disk members are constrained to rotate with the bell member and the remainder with the ring member. A lubricating and cooling liquid is fed into the interior of the ring member, and can reach the disk members through a plurality of holes in the ring member. A generally annular scoop member is rotatably disposed within the ring member. It is constrained to rotate with the driving shaft and has a cylindrical peripheral wall disposed between the liquid feed means and the ring member. Its dimension in the axial direction is substantially the same as that of the ring member.

    Abstract: An automatic clutch control system including a clutch, a clutch actuator for controlling a clutch stroke, a plurality of solenoid valves for controlling the clutch actuator, a clutch stroke sensor for measuring the clutch stroke, a control unit for feeding back a stroke signal detected by the clutch stroke sensor and for controlling the solenoid valves to control clutch engagement and disengagement. The control unit includes a learning control section for storing a full clutch engagement point upon saturation of the stroke signal in a clutch engagement operation and storing clutch contact point upon start of rotation of an engine input shaft in a clutch engagement operation following a clutch disengagement operation. Based on the full clutch engagement point and clutch contact point, the control unit judges a clutch operation range for control of clutch engagement and disengagement.
